Distributed lag non-linear models
Explore this paper's citation graph
Summary
A modelling framework that can simultaneously represent non-linear exposure–response dependencies and delayed effects, based on the definition of a ‘cross-basis’, which is implemented in the package dlnm within the statistical environment R.
